A bite reliever is a healthcare or first-aid product designed to reduce itching, pain, swelling, and irritation caused by insect bites or stings. It is commonly used to soothe the skin after bites from insects such as Mosquito, Bee, Wasp, and Ant. Bite relievers are available in several forms, including creams, gels, sprays, roll-ons, and electronic devices, and are widely used in homes, travel kits, outdoor activities, and first-aid kits.
Purpose and Function
The primary purpose of a bite reliever is to calm the skin and reduce discomfort after an insect bite or sting. Insect bites often cause reactions such as redness, itching, or mild swelling due to the body’s response to substances introduced by the insect.
A bite reliever works by soothing the irritated skin, reducing inflammation, and relieving itching, which helps prevent scratching that could lead to further irritation or infection.
Types of Bite Relievers
Bite relievers are available in several different forms depending on the treatment method.
Topical Creams or Gels
These are applied directly to the skin and often contain soothing ingredients that reduce itching and irritation.
Sprays or Roll-On Solutions
Liquid solutions that can be easily applied to the affected area, often used for quick treatment during outdoor activities.
Electronic Bite Relievers
Some devices use controlled heat or small electric pulses to relieve itching and discomfort caused by insect bites.
Natural Remedies
Certain bite relievers use plant-based ingredients known for their calming effects on irritated skin.
Common Ingredients
Many bite relief products contain ingredients that help soothe the skin and reduce inflammation. Common ingredients include:
Hydrocortisone – helps reduce inflammation and itching
Calamine – soothes irritated skin
Aloe Vera – provides cooling and moisturizing effects
Tea Tree Oil – known for its antimicrobial properties
Menthol – creates a cooling sensation that relieves itching
The combination of these ingredients helps provide quick and effective relief from bite-related discomfort.
How It Works
Bite relievers typically work through one or more of the following mechanisms:
Cooling the Skin – ingredients like menthol produce a cooling sensation that reduces itching.
Reducing Inflammation – anti-inflammatory ingredients help decrease swelling and redness.
Soothing Irritation – moisturizing and calming substances help restore skin comfort.
Neutralizing Irritants – some treatments help reduce the effect of insect saliva or venom.

Safety and Precautions
While bite relievers are generally safe, it is important to follow instructions carefully:
Apply only to clean, unbroken skin
Avoid contact with eyes or mouth
Follow dosage guidelines for children and adults
Seek medical attention if severe allergic reactions occur
